AI Summary
-
Reduces public hearing notice period from 45 days to 30 days for liquor license applications in counties with a population of 500,000 or more.
-
Reduces the timeline for mailing notices to property owners, residents, and businesses from 45 days to 30 days prior to the hearing date in counties with 500,000+ population.
-
Applies the expedited 30-day timeline only to counties meeting the 500,000 population threshold; all other counties maintain the original 45-day requirement.
-
Maintains all other existing requirements for public notice content, mailing lists, affidavits, and hearing procedures.
